- The Housekeeping Supervisor is responsible for overseeing the daily operations of the housekeeping team while ensuring exceptional cleanliness, organization, and presentation standards throughout the club and resort facilities.
- This position provides direct supervision, training, scheduling support, quality assurance, and day-to-day leadership for housekeeping personnel.
- The ideal candidate is a proactive leader who leads by example, takes pride in developing team members, and maintains the highest levels of accountability, safety, service, and attention to detail in a luxury hospitality environment.
- Located on the west shore of Lake Tahoe, Homewood Mountain Resort is a beloved four-season destination known for its stunning lake views, intimate slopes, and commitment to personalized guest experiences.
